Core Responsibilities of a Private Estate Manager
An exceptional Estate Manager in Monte Carlo oversees all aspects of household operations, from staff management to property maintenance coordination. Their responsibilities extend far beyond basic household management:
- Managing and coordinating multiple household staff members across various departments
- Overseeing property maintenance, renovations, and vendor relationships
- Managing household budgets, expenses, and financial reporting
- Coordinating complex travel arrangements and logistics for family members
- Ensuring security protocols and privacy standards are maintained
- Managing inventory, purchasing, and procurement for the estate
- Organizing and executing high-profile events and entertaining
Essential Qualifications and Experience
The most effective Estate Managers bring a combination of formal education, specialized training, and proven experience in luxury private service. Employers should seek candidates with:
- Formal qualifications in hospitality management, business administration, or estate management
- Certifications from recognized institutions such as the International Butler Academy
- Minimum 5-10 years of experience managing large private residences or luxury properties
- Fluency in multiple languages, particularly French and English for Monaco-based positions
- Strong financial management and budgeting skills
- Exceptional communication and leadership abilities

Compensation and Market Insights
Estate Manager salaries in Monte Carlo typically range from €120,000 to €250,000 annually, with exceptional candidates commanding higher packages. The principality's tax advantages attract wealthy families, but also drive up living costs significantly. Key considerations include:
- Housing allowances: Essential given Monaco's extreme property prices
- Multilingual requirements: French fluency mandatory, with English and Italian highly valued
- Work permits: EU nationals preferred due to simplified visa processes
- Discretion premium: High-profile clients often require enhanced confidentiality agreements
Successful Estate Manager candidates typically possess hospitality management backgrounds, extensive wine knowledge, and experience coordinating with Monaco's luxury service providers. The role often extends to managing yacht crews and coordinating with properties in nearby Cannes, Cap d'Antibes, and Saint-Tropez.

Should I hire a live-in or live-out Estate Manager in Monaco?
The choice between live-in and live-out depends on your specific needs:
Live-in advantages: 24/7 availability, immediate response to emergencies, property security, lower accommodation costs for the employer.
Live-out advantages: Clear work-life boundaries, potentially broader candidate pool, no need for staff quarters.
In Monaco's limited space environment, many families opt for live-out arrangements due to property constraints. Our consultants will help you determine the best arrangement based on your property layout, security needs, and lifestyle requirements.

What trial period and contract terms are typical for Estate Managers in Monaco?
Standard practice includes:
- Initial trial period of 3-6 months to assess fit
- Detailed employment contract outlining responsibilities, compensation, and terms
- Notice periods typically 1-3 months depending on seniority
- Annual performance reviews and salary adjustments
- Confidentiality and non-disclosure agreements
Lighthouse Careers provides guidance on contract structuring to ensure compliance with Monaco employment law while protecting your interests. We recommend working with local legal counsel to finalize employment agreements for your Estate Manager position.
